BIRTH DEBRIEFING SESSIONS:

Integrating and processing your story and support to heal after challenging or traumatic experience. Help to integrate your experience, particularly if you are planning to have another baby (or not). PREGNANCY SESSIONS:

Support with fears around birth or postpartum, and support to make a plan to help you have the most positive transition to motherhood as possible. Support with anxiety, low mood, relationship concerns, unplanned pregnancy, previous difficult birth, pregnancy loss, previous life trauma (sexual violence, childhood trauma, PTSD). BIRTH PLANNING SESSIONS:

Childbirth preparation from a mind-body, trauma informed perspective. Holding space for inner work to uncover what will help you in your rite of passage and transition to parenting. POSTNATAL SESSIONS:

Fourth trimester support (and beyond), parenting and newborn support, identity transition and matrescence, support with feeling anxious or overwhelmed, bonding with your baby, relationship challenges, birth trauma support. TRAUMA-INFORMED HOLISTIC COUNSELLING:

Sessions for women wanting support to heal after trauma, childhood abuse or developmental trauma, domestic violence, or sexual violence. Support with general anxiety or depression, sleep issues, or low mood. MENTORING & SUPERVISION FOR SOCIAL WORKERS/DOULAS

Now offering support and mentoring for other doulas and birthworkers who want space to debrief with their work, how it's impacting them, and support for vicarious trauma. Also offering support and supervision for social workers (especially working in perinatal mental health). IN-PERSON SESSIONS:

To the extent that we are egos, we are somebodies. We come down and we become a somebody. As that awareness starts to identify as a soul, it immediately feels separate from our mother and everything else. Then we begin to experience another separation, now as ego.

So it’s a separation within a separation, if you will. That’s the descent into more and more dense form, and that form is what we live out as an incarnation. Somewhere along the line in that story, we awaken. We begin to realize we are not only the incarnation, that there is more to us than meets the eyes, and we begin to realize that the more that we think we are, we are. That leads us to re-look at our experiences and to open to new experiences that allow us to enter into other planes of consciousness, other perspectives, other ways of looking at it.

That awakening starts and at first, because you have been in such a thick substance, you’ve been so very entrapped in your story, in your body, in your suffering, that when you awaken there is a joy, a breath… it’s like coming above smog when you fly. But there is also a kind of fear of getting trapped again, and a tendency to push against the stuff you were trapped in. You can use that like a rocket booster to get you out there.

Ultimately though, as you get established more as a soul, more established as just awareness, which isn’t even you anymore, as those become more real, and you become more comfortable in them, you look and you see that the incarnation that you have taken wasn’t an error and it wasn’t failure, and you’re not making mistakes. It is just an unfolding process.

And it’s nothing so personal about it all. Your personality isn’t that interesting. At that point you start to, from a soul’s point of view, inhabit your incarnation, at first resignedly, and then ultimately joyfully, because it’s just God at play. It’s just form, it’s just form.

- Ram Dass

Brisbane Doula- Prenatal & Postnatal Services

Are you pregnant and feeling worried about your birth and what comes after?

Is your precious bundle in your arms, but you’re struggling more than you ever imagined?

During pregnancy I work with women who might have worries or fear about their upcoming birth, or who have experienced a previous difficult or traumatic birth. I work with parents who want to prepare for their birth as the major milestone and rite of passage that it is, and who want to feel fully supported and open to facing the unknown with courage and love.

After the birth I help nurture new parents to feel confident and connected to their baby and their intuition. For new mothers I offer nourishing postpartum meals, brief massage, breastfeeding support and newborn settling. I also provide birth debriefing and professional counselling to support parents to make sense of challenging or traumatic birth experiences.
